FAQs about hotels in Manchester
On average, 3-star hotels in Manchester cost £85 per night, and 4-star hotels in Manchester are £140 per night. If you're looking for something really special, a 5-star hotel in Manchester can be found for £198 per night, on average (based on Booking.com prices).
The average price per night for a 3-star hotel in Manchester this weekend is £130 or, for a 4-star hotel, £232. Looking for something even fancier? 5-star hotels in Manchester for this weekend cost around £324 per night, on average (based on Booking.com prices).
With an industrial past and a modern outlook, the complex fabric of Manchester is interlaced with interesting museums, English pubs and shopping centers.
Dash straight into the luxurious Selfridges and Triangle departments stores before checking out the old-English charm of the Shambles.
Manchester wouldn't be the same without its 2 famous football clubs and fans can go wild at either of the Old Trafford or City of Manchester Stadiums. Music fans will adore the many shows performed at the Manchester Arena, the largest of its type in Europe, and the BBC Philharmonic Orchestra.
The cultural foundations of this predominantly red-brick city are on display at the Manchester Museum and the People’s History Museum. If art is you preference, the extensive pre-Raphaelite collection at the Manchester Art Gallery is a sight to behold.

Best was: Bridgewater RHS Gardens (best), War Museum, Lowery...
Best was: Bridgewater RHS Gardens (best), War Museum, Lowery, Mrs Gaskell's House, Pankhurst Centre, Peoples Museum, Trafford Centre.
In general there is a lot to do in Manchester and was our 3rd visit.
Trams are fun.
Less good: Science Museum as intended more for children.

Beautiful industrial heritage buildings together with...
Beautiful industrial heritage buildings together with impressive modern architecture. Excellent tram network. Visited the historic John Ryland's Library and the Hidden Gem Catholic Church. Lots of options for eating and good quality food. Very friendly people ready to help. Worth visiting Afflick's market for bargains, super good ice cream and great ambiance. Also the Craft and Design Centre, housed in the former Fish Market.
